Our Squadron is a diverse and inclusive youth organisation, sponsored by the Royal Air Force, and is keen to embrace opportunities in Air, Space and Cyberspace. We provide focused activities and experiences in flying, gliding, sport, adventurous training, drill, cyber skills and the Duke of Edinburgh’s Award Scheme. The cadet academic training programme is linked externally with the SQA. We encourage a practical interest in aviation and the Royal Air Force but there is no obligation to join the Services. The skills that cadets gain can help them with whatever they want to do in life be it civilian or military. We seek to encourage the spirit of adventure and develop qualities of leadership and good citizenship. That includes being able to communicate clearly, work as a member of a team, enhance social skills and accept diversity. Training is provided by our suitably qualified subject matter specialists. All staff at the Squadron both uniformed and civilian, are unpaid volunteers.

Objectives: The purpose of the Squadron Association (‘the Association’) is to fully support the squadron commander to further the objects of the Air Training Corps (‘the ATC’) as contained in the Schedule to the Royal Warrant as amended from time to time but in particular to support activities which foster the spirit of adventure amongst the squadron’s cadets and develop their qualities of leadership and good citizenship.
